Abstract
A fail-fixed servovalve is provided for use in a digital control system. The servovalve is comprised of a deflecting means which deflects a jet pipe in response to an electrical input signal. Fluid flowing through the jet pipe causes a spool to translate within a sleeve, thereby allowing pressurized fluid to flow through selected ports within the sleeve to control the movement of an output piston. The output of the servovalve is essentially linear over the primary range of digital input currents with the output being zero when the input current is either zero or in excess of the maximum rated current for the servovalve.
